2. Overview of Lithium Energy Batteries


Lithium batteries are a type of rechargeable battery that utilizes lithium ions as a primary component of its electrochemistry. The structure of these batteries allows for higher energy density compared to other battery types, making them an ideal choice for portable electronics. This section will explore the fundamental components and working mechanisms that contribute to the effectiveness of lithium batteries.

Understanding Lithium-Ion Technology


Lithium-ion technology involves the movement of lithium ions between the anode and the cathode during charge and discharge cycles. This process enables the storage and release of energy, providing a consistent power supply essential for modern devices. The efficiency of lithium batteries is attributed to their ability to hold more charge while minimizing weight—an essential feature for smartphones and laptops where portability is critical.

3. Key Benefits of Lithium Energy Batteries in Consumer Electronics


Lithium energy batteries present several advantages that enhance the performance of electronic devices. Here, we will discuss three significant benefits that these batteries offer.

3.1 Long-lasting Performance


One of the standout features of lithium batteries is their long-lasting performance. Unlike traditional batteries that experience rapid depletion, lithium batteries maintain a consistent energy output over extended periods. This resilience is vital for users who rely on their devices throughout the day without frequent recharging.

3.2 Fast Charging Technology


Fast charging is a game-changer in the realm of consumer electronics. Lithium batteries can charge at a much faster rate compared to other battery types. Innovations in charging technology mean that users can power up their smartphones and laptops within minutes rather than hours, enhancing user convenience and efficiency.

3.3 Lightweight and Compact Design


The lightweight and compact design of lithium batteries is another essential benefit. As manufacturers strive to create thinner and lighter devices, lithium batteries play a crucial role. Their energy density allows for the production of slim devices without compromising on battery life or performance.

8. Frequently Asked Questions


1. What are lithium energy batteries?


Lithium energy batteries are rechargeable batteries that use lithium ions to store and release energy, known for their high energy density and efficiency.

2. How do lithium batteries compare to traditional batteries?


Lithium batteries offer longer life cycles, faster charging times, and greater energy density compared to traditional battery types like nickel-cadmium.

3. What devices use lithium energy batteries?


Lithium energy batteries are commonly used in smartphones, laptops, tablets, electric vehicles, and various portable electronic devices.

4. Why are lithium batteries preferred for consumer electronics?


Lithium batteries are preferred because they provide longer usage times, quick charging, and a lightweight design, enhancing the overall user experience.

5. What is the future of lithium energy batteries?


The future of lithium energy batteries includes advancements in solid-state technology, improved recycling methods, and enhanced performance capabilities, aiming for a more sustainable approach in technology.
